Many myths were based on the fact that gods, like mortal men, could be punished or rewarded for their actions. The 5th-century-bce Greek historian Herodotus remarked that Homer and Hesiod gave to the Olympian gods their familiar characteristics.Few today would accept this literally.

The Greek Myths (1955) is a mythography, a compendium of Greek mythology, with comments and analyses, by the poet and writer Robert Graves.Many editions of the book separate it into two volumes.
